So I was thinking back to some old MMO games the other day and something I always thought was quite fun as the random events that would take place! What I think that would make the game epic would be to have special enemies such as titans or super powered enemies that spawn in each zone say, every 2 hours! They give a huge amount of xp and a chance at daedric themed items like furnishings or motifs?

    Yes, but i would rather it worked like...
    I would rather a random timer and maybe a random zone.

    I used to play Ragnarok Online where it had overworld boss monsters which had set spawn times. It would become a thing where you would note kill times on them and then farm respawns.

    Also they would need to have some true hitting power. This could also be something which encourages open world competition with the top 12 loot thing, although that's one for debate.

  • Leandor
    Leandor
    ✭✭✭✭✭
    ✭✭
    It' anticlimactic to have an overworld boss that is more difficult to defeat than Molag Bal or the Celestials.

    Having open world bosses spawn randomly and then be defeated by trained 8 or 12 man groups kind of defeats the purpose and will only result in aggravation for the overwhelming majority of players.

    In this game of soloists, to organize and coordinate 50+ players to defeat a worldboss appropriately powered is impossible.

    I hated overworld bosses in most of the games I played. We will not get back the times of Ultima or DAoC, players have changed too much.

    Solid NOOOO from my point of view.
